Establish a stand-alone installer for JBDSIS that will contain JBDS and will enable
easier installation of JBDSIS components - specifically Fuse Tooling. This Jira is
specifically related to the JBDSIS installer. Other usability issues will be handled in
other Jira.
Installation scenario:
{code}
1. If you don't already have one installed, you will need to download and install
Oracle or Open JDK 8. (make sure you have Java 1.8 installed)
2. Download the JBDSIS installer jar. i.e. wget
https://devstudio.redhat.com/9.0/snapshots/updates/integration-stack/9.0....
3. Double-click the installer file to run it, or open a terminal and type `java -jar
/path/to/installer-*.jar`
4. Select 'JBoss Fuse Development' from the 'Select Additional Features to
Install' installer window.
5. Accept/ respond 'Yes' and restart
6. Select Window > Perspective > Open Perspective > Fuse Integration
{code}
